is there a way (maybe its already in the options) we can filter out specific forums. say, for example, I no longer really want to see anything that goes on in the pub, because in my opinion the IQ level of that forum has been dropping rapidly (opinion here, I'm just using it to exercise my question). so, is there any way, other than adding individual users to my ignore list, that individual forums could be blocked?
Necropolis
27 Jun 2005, 8:43pm
Here is a trick Shorty showed me. This link will give you all the new posts excluding the ones from the pub
http://www.short-media.com/forum/search.php?do=getnew&exclude=23
and this link will do the same but also exclude milestones and spyware forum
http://www.short-media.com/forum/search.php?do=getnew&exclude=23,26,57
